Understanding the PTE
Before diving into the preparation methods, it's important to understand what the PTE Academic Test Certificate requires. The test examines four abilities: Listening, Reading, Speaking, and Writing, with an overall duration of roughly 3 hours.

How is the PTE scored?
The PTE is scored on a scale from 10 to 90, with individual ratings offered each skill location and a general score. The scores show your efficiency level based upon the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R).
2. Can I retake the PTE test?
Yes, candidates can retake the PTE as many times as needed. Nevertheless, a waiting period of five days is required between efforts.
3. What is the validity of the PTE certificate?
The PTE certificate stands for 2 years from the test date.
4. Exist any requirements for taking the PTE?
There are no formal prerequisites to take the PTE, but familiarity with the English language is important for effective completion.
